Steeped in history, the iconic Peter Hayward Tavern circa 1764 is a rare legacy property encompassing approximately 191 acres spanning both Surry and Keene, New Hampshire. The offering includes the historic main residence, substantial barn, and approximately 140 acres in Surry with an additional 50 acres in Keene, much of it protected in current use and conservation. Ideally situated across from Bretwood Golf Course and within walking distance to Goose Pond Recreation Area, the setting offers an exceptional blend of privacy, recreation, and natural beauty. The classic center chimney Cape with attached ell is an extraordinary example of early American craftsmanship, showcasing original woodwork, graceful arched fireplace surrounds, and six fireplaces connected to five separate flues within the massive central chimney. Surry is located in New Hampshire. Surry, New Hampshire has a population of 942. Surry is more family-centric than the surrounding county with 33.6%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 26.09%.
The median household income in Surry, New Hampshire is $89,464. The median household income for the surrounding county is $69,360 compared to the national median of $69,021. The median age of people living in Surry is 44.2 years.
The average high temperature in July is 81.5 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 8.8 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 45.1 inches per year, with 55.4 inches of snow per year.
